York Historical Education Level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
Total population: 12,661
York | Maine | U.S. | |
Total 25 Years and Over Population | 9,879, 100% | 947,959 | 209,056,129 |
Less Than High School | 240, 2.43%, see rank | 8.69% | 13.67% |
High School Graduate | 2,143, 21.69%, see rank | 33.55% | 27.95% |
Some College or Associate Degree | 2,759, 27.93%, see rank | 29.40% | 29.09% |
Bachelor Degree | 3,166, 32.05%, see rank | 18.28% | 18.27% |
Master, Doctorate, or Professional Degree | 1,571, 15.90%, see rank | 10.08% | 11.01% |
USA.com Education Index# | 14.86, see rank | 13.68 | 13.54 |
# Higher USA.com Education Index means more educated population.
